找回密码
 立即注册
搜索
查看: 2756|回复: 34

[软件] PC串流如何解决显示长宽比例不同的问题?

[复制链接]
     
发表于 2024-8-25 16:35 | 显示全部楼层 |阅读模式
本帖最后由 GMJ 于 2024-8-25 16:37 编辑

目前是moonlight+sunshine的组合实现的串流

但我的PC显示器是21:9的,电视是16:9的
导致串流过去的时候电视上只能显示中间一部分,上下黑边的形式

用moonlight+geforce experience的shield实现的话,电视倒是能全屏显示,但显示内容是被压缩比例的,所有内容都扁扁高高的了,
要怎么弄才能把电视作为副屏和显示器各自独立分辨率啊,另外我也不想别人在串流玩游戏的时候我显示器上也顶个游戏画面,完全可以做到他在其他房间打游戏,我管自己办公、刷视频的吧



另外,求问客厅的PS5要怎么投屏到卧室,ps5装不了sunshine,也没geforce experience有的shield啊
回复

使用道具 举报

     
发表于 2024-8-25 16:47 | 显示全部楼层
买个HDMI欺骗器就能输出到副屏自定义分辨率了

至于PS5,那用的是PS Remote Play,和sunshine+moonlight不是一套东西
https://remoteplay.dl.playstatio ... /lang/cs/index.html
回复

使用道具 举报

     
发表于 2024-8-25 16:54 来自手机 | 显示全部楼层
本帖最后由 dvd6 于 2024-8-25 17:03 编辑

pc试试这个虚拟显示器驱动,分辨率可以在配置文件里随意加
https://github.com/itsmikethetech/Virtual-Display-Driver
配合moonlight有个阿西西修改版可以任意自定义分辨率(但是这个版本开源情况有点不明确)
补充:刚看见有人说这个阿西西似乎有抄袭白嫖嫌疑,可能得另找其他fork版本了

—— 来自 鹅球 v3.1.88.2-alpha
回复

使用道具 举报

     
 楼主| 发表于 2024-8-25 16:57 | 显示全部楼层
password 发表于 2024-8-25 16:47
买个HDMI欺骗器就能输出到副屏自定义分辨率了

至于PS5,那用的是PS Remote Play,和sunshine+moonlight不 ...

笑死,国内PS Remote Play根本下不动
回复

使用道具 举报

     
发表于 2024-8-25 17:07 | 显示全部楼层
https://bbs.saraba1st.com/2b/for ... =%E4%B8%B2%E6%B5%81

用sunshie串流,创建一个虚拟显示器驱动,平时不使用
串流时,用脚本关闭你主显示器,然后打开虚拟显示器,串流虚拟显示器
结束时反之

视频教程
https://www.bilibili.com/video/BV19G41127y8/
回复

使用道具 举报

     
发表于 2024-8-25 17:39 来自手机 | 显示全部楼层
【自动切换屏幕、分辨率?基地版sunshine+魔改moonlight 串流毕业! 【win11 主机 保姆级教学】-哔哩哔哩】 https://b23.tv/dMS7xqK

用基地版,试过其他方法,但这个方便
回复

使用道具 举报

     
发表于 2024-8-25 18:08 | 显示全部楼层
本帖最后由 Saker_bobo 于 2024-8-25 18:11 编辑

sunshine在配置 General最下面的config.do_cmd config.undo_cmd 可以填个cmd改分辨率的命令 连接时执行do 退出时执行undo

仔细看了下 感觉你还是得用虚拟显示器法
回复

使用道具 举报

     
 楼主| 发表于 2024-8-25 19:24 | 显示全部楼层
我的显示器是lG34UC88,有多个输入口,目前就用了一个DP线的接口,
这个显示器支持多输入来源,可以同时显示2个设备的输入画面,并设定不同的分割比例,或画中画和
那我是不是可以再用一根HDMI线接上显示器,设定5+16:21的分割方案,让电脑认为是他是个16:9,一个5:9  两个显示来实现效果?(虽然卧室有人打游戏的时候我这里只能用5:19的竖条显示器了。。。
回复

使用道具 举报

     
发表于 2024-8-25 20:39 | 显示全部楼层
GMJ 发表于 2024-8-25 19:24
我的显示器是lG34UC88,有多个输入口,目前就用了一个DP线的接口,
这个显示器支持多输入来源,可以同时显示 ...

没这么复杂,就parsec virtual display driver创建一个虚拟的屏幕,对应你电视的分辨率,然后sunshine选择这个屏幕进行串流就行了,我手机2160x1914这种奇葩分辨率都能够拿来完美投屏
回复

使用道具 举报

     
发表于 2024-8-25 23:31 来自手机 | 显示全部楼层
提个关联问题:我现在用虚拟屏幕方案,虚拟屏作为第二屏,串流时为了让物理显示器不要亮着,多屏模式设置为仅使用第二屏。但为了避免意外情况比如sunshine卡死或无法连接导致只能摸黑盲操,我希望电脑启动之后(或者其他容易触发的条件)自动切换回物理屏幕,有什么好方法?
查到命令行可以使用displayswitch /internal来切换,实测命令行直接运行也有效,但用计划任务来调用为啥就不行呢?无论用各种触发条件,还是手动点运行都没反应。是权限问题?
回复

使用道具 举报

     
发表于 2024-8-25 23:43 | 显示全部楼层
dvd6 发表于 2024-8-25 23:31
提个关联问题:我现在用虚拟屏幕方案,虚拟屏作为第二屏,串流时为了让物理显示器不要亮着,多屏模式设置为 ...

只有一主一副用ahk脚本热键控制displayswitch就行了

如果总屏幕数多于两个还是买个displayfusion吧
回复

使用道具 举报

     
发表于 2024-8-25 23:45 | 显示全部楼层
dvd6 发表于 2024-8-25 23:31
提个关联问题:我现在用虚拟屏幕方案,虚拟屏作为第二屏,串流时为了让物理显示器不要亮着,多屏模式设置为 ...

五楼第一个链接,有坛友的方案
我个人是用Quicker写了个切屏幕和音箱的脚本
回复

使用道具 举报

     
发表于 2024-8-26 00:41 来自手机 | 显示全部楼层
都太复杂了,我直接用steam remote play,我也是台式机带鱼屏

— from OnePlus CPH2551, Android 14 of S1 Next Goose v2.5.4
回复

使用道具 举报

     
发表于 2024-8-26 00:53 | 显示全部楼层
硫黄 发表于 2024-8-25 23:45
五楼第一个链接,有坛友的方案
我个人是用Quicker写了个切屏幕和音箱的脚本 ...

谢谢,我估计用他提到的禁用虚拟设备的命令就可以了
回复

使用道具 举报

     
发表于 2024-8-26 00:58 | 显示全部楼层
PS5远程用chiaki-ng(原来的chiaki4deck)就行
回复

使用道具 举报

     
发表于 2024-8-26 00:59 | 显示全部楼层
password 发表于 2024-8-25 23:43
只有一主一副用ahk脚本热键控制displayswitch就行了

如果总屏幕数多于两个还是买个displayfusion吧 ...

5楼的帖子里提到登录前是没法切换显示器的,如果开机时意外没运行sunshine或者网络有问题就要摸黑了。事实上登录界面win+p确实是不行,displayswitch可能也一样
回复

使用道具 举报

     
发表于 2024-8-26 07:29 | 显示全部楼层
dvd6 发表于 2024-8-26 00:59
5楼的帖子里提到登录前是没法切换显示器的,如果开机时意外没运行sunshine或者网络有问题就要摸黑了。事实 ...


所以我用欺骗器 一个几块钱有问题拔了就是

热键是平时切换用的
回复

使用道具 举报

     
发表于 2024-8-26 08:24 | 显示全部楼层
其实都不好用
不论是虚拟屏还是插HDMI负载,尤其本身就是多屏幕的时候。
当你准备串流前需要做一系列的准备动作,串流后还要做一些列的恢复动作,着实很影响兴致。
回复

使用道具 举报

     
发表于 2024-8-26 08:40 | 显示全部楼层
浅仓透透 发表于 2024-8-26 08:24
其实都不好用
不论是虚拟屏还是插HDMI负载,尤其本身就是多屏幕的时候。
当你准备串流前需要做一系列的准备 ...

这些事情基本都能用ahk一键实现,比如切换加启动steam大屏模式
回复

使用道具 举报

     
发表于 2024-8-26 08:43 来自手机 | 显示全部楼层
借楼求教串流黑神话显示drm保护怎么解决?直接用桌面模式帧数降得太离谱了。
回复

使用道具 举报

     
发表于 2024-8-26 08:48 | 显示全部楼层
password 发表于 2024-8-26 07:29
所以我用欺骗器 一个几块钱有问题拔了就是

热键是平时切换用的

欺骗器能否自定义任意分辨率+高刷?
回复

使用道具 举报

     
发表于 2024-8-26 08:52 | 显示全部楼层
dvd6 发表于 2024-8-26 08:48
欺骗器能否自定义任意分辨率+高刷?

可以的,具体建议买之前找卖家确认下规格
回复

使用道具 举报

     
发表于 2024-8-26 08:53 | 显示全部楼层
dvd6 发表于 2024-8-26 08:48
欺骗器能否自定义任意分辨率+高刷?

不能 欺骗器的都是写入edid 买的时候挑好
回复

使用道具 举报

     
发表于 2024-8-26 09:00 | 显示全部楼层
汝者 发表于 2024-8-26 08:53
不能 欺骗器的都是写入edid 买的时候挑好

可以的 我试过用nv自定义分辨率输出到欺骗器上实现了ipad pro11分辨率+120hz
回复

使用道具 举报

     
发表于 2024-8-26 09:08 | 显示全部楼层
password 发表于 2024-8-26 09:00
可以的 我试过用nv自定义分辨率输出到欺骗器上实现了ipad pro11分辨率+120hz

我买了几个都不行 后来干脆不折腾了
回复

使用道具 举报

     
发表于 2024-8-26 10:16 | 显示全部楼层
password 发表于 2024-8-26 09:00
可以的 我试过用nv自定义分辨率输出到欺骗器上实现了ipad pro11分辨率+120hz

能否直接推荐一个
之前就是怕折腾这种问题直接就用了虚拟的方案
回复

使用道具 举报

     
发表于 2024-8-26 10:48 | 显示全部楼层
dvd6 发表于 2024-8-26 10:16
能否直接推荐一个
之前就是怕折腾这种问题直接就用了虚拟的方案

我是好几年前买的,那店我看了下倒是还在,链接我可以PM你,但我不能保证现在商家卖的版本有同样效果
回复

使用道具 举报

     
发表于 2024-8-26 10:57 来自手机 | 显示全部楼层
不是,就算串流副屏,也没法两边同时操作吧?不会互相争夺鼠标焦点吗?

—— 来自 Xiaomi 22061218C, Android 14上的 S1Next-鹅版 v3.0.0-alpha
回复

使用道具 举报

     
发表于 2024-8-26 14:10 | 显示全部楼层
password 发表于 2024-8-26 10:48
我是好几年前买的,那店我看了下倒是还在,链接我可以PM你,但我不能保证现在商家卖的版本有同样效果 ...

收到了,谢谢,我再问下商家吧
回复

使用道具 举报

     
发表于 2024-8-26 14:23 | 显示全部楼层
downforce 发表于 2024-8-26 10:57
不是,就算串流副屏,也没法两边同时操作吧?不会互相争夺鼠标焦点吗?

—— 来自 Xiaomi 22061218C, Andr ...

确实,都忽略了lz后面那个问题……
回复

使用道具 举报

     
发表于 2024-8-26 16:28 来自手机 | 显示全部楼层
GMJ 发表于 2024-8-25 16:57
笑死,国内PS Remote Play根本下不动

ps5用chiaki或者psplay这些第三方app.,比官方remoteplay要好

—— 来自 鹅球 v3.0.86-alpha
回复

使用道具 举报

     
发表于 2024-8-27 00:54 | 显示全部楼层
password 发表于 2024-8-26 10:48
我是好几年前买的,那店我看了下倒是还在,链接我可以PM你,但我不能保证现在商家卖的版本有同样效果 ...

问了你发的店,现在已经不支持自定义特殊分辨率了。其他问了几家也不行,部分是可定制,特殊分辨率他给你写进去,但都不能自己在驱动里添加
回复

使用道具 举报

     
发表于 2024-8-28 11:33 | 显示全部楼层
本帖最后由 password 于 2024-8-28 11:36 编辑
dvd6 发表于 2024-8-27 00:54
问了你发的店,现在已经不支持自定义特殊分辨率了。其他问了几家也不行,部分是可定制,特殊分辨率他给你 ...

我又想了想,要不你就用虚拟的,试试displayfusion能不能在开机时就载入你指定的Monitor Profile
https://www.displayfusion.com/He ... orProfileOnStartup/

还有个思路是你整个Windows Hallo 指纹或者人脸,这样即使抹黑也可以轻松登录
回复

使用道具 举报

     
发表于 2024-8-28 12:37 来自手机 | 显示全部楼层
password 发表于 2024-8-28 11:33
我又想了想,要不你就用虚拟的,试试displayfusion能不能在开机时就载入你指定的Monitor Profile
https:// ...

我先试试前面的禁用设备方式。不过考虑欺骗器是因为,虚拟方案我有时候怀疑有稳定性问题导致游戏时串流卡死(非游戏期间有时好像出现设备重载现象),但也不完全确定是虚拟的问题,还是串流问题,或是两者配合的问题

—— 来自 鹅球 v3.1.88.2-alpha
回复

使用道具 举报

     
发表于 2024-9-1 21:23 来自手机 | 显示全部楼层
password 发表于 2024-8-28 11:33
我又想了想,要不你就用虚拟的,试试displayfusion能不能在开机时就载入你指定的Monitor Profile
https:// ...

我今天又想了想,发现之前真是想太多。。。
原来只要平常用保持仅第1屏(物理屏)模式,习惯不用的时候把显示器关掉,串流就会自动切换到唯一能识别的虚拟屏;当重新打开物理屏后因为它还是主屏,所以无论显卡信号和串流都自动切回物理屏。实在需要临时在外面控制的话以后搞个智能开关,顺便把主机的通电也控制了

—— 来自 鹅球 v3.1.88.2-alpha
回复

使用道具 举报

您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

Archiver|手机版|小黑屋|上海互联网违法和不良信息举报中心|网上有害信息举报专区|962110 反电信诈骗|举报电话 021-62035905|Stage1st ( 沪ICP备13020230号-1|沪公网安备 31010702007642号 )

GMT+8, 2024-11-9 00:31 , Processed in 0.132560 second(s), 5 queries , Gzip On, Redis On.

Powered by Discuz! X3.5

© 2001-2024 Discuz! Team.

快速回复 返回顶部 返回列表